Who we are

Forming capable learners and compassionate citizens.

Our motto, To Serve, But Not To Be Served, guides the way we approach school life. It calls us to match academic ambition with humility, care, resilience, and a practical commitment to community.

From the classroom to the sports field, students are encouraged to be curious, dependable, and ready to contribute.
